Medicaid eligibility and enrollment vary by state
In the United States, Medicaid and the Children's Health Insurance Program (CHIP) provide health and long-term care coverage to almost 82 million people. This includes low-income children, pregnant women, adults, seniors, and people with disabilities. While the federal government has general rules that all state Medicaid programs must follow, each state runs its own program within federal standards, and eligibility rules differ among states.
In New Jersey, the state-provided health insurance is called Horizon NJ Health, and it manages the Medicaid benefits for children and adults in Medicaid and NJ FamilyCare programs. NJ Family Care is the entity that runs New Jersey's Medicaid program, and it is the organization to which you apply for coverage. They handle the specifics of rules and income requirements. NJ Family Care has five different HMOs, and while you are able to select an HMO when applying, it is not required to submit an application. If you do not choose an HMO, one will be selected for you.
To check your eligibility for Medicaid, you can apply through the Health Insurance Marketplace. If someone in your household qualifies for Medicaid, the Marketplace will forward your application to your state for a final eligibility decision. You can also call the Marketplace Call Center at 1-800-318-2596 to apply.
It is important to note that each state's Medicaid and CHIP programs are constantly changing and improving. Therefore, it is recommended to refer to the official websites and resources for the most up-to-date information regarding eligibility and enrollment requirements in your specific state.

NJ FamilyCare runs New Jersey's Medicaid program
In the state of New Jersey, the Medicaid program is called NJ FamilyCare. It is a publicly funded health insurance program that provides free or low-cost health insurance to qualifying New Jersey residents of all ages. NJ FamilyCare is the entity that runs New Jersey's Medicaid program and is the organisation to which you apply for coverage.
Horizon NJ Health is a health insurance company that provides coverage to those enrolled in the NJ FamilyCare program. It is one of five Health Maintenance Organisations (HMOs) that are available to those enrolled in NJ FamilyCare. The other four are Aetna Better Health of New Jersey, Amerigroup, United Healthcare Community Plan, and Wellcare of New Jersey. Wellcare of New Jersey is not available in Hunterdon County.
When applying for NJ FamilyCare, you are able to select an HMO, but this is not required to submit an application. If you do not choose an HMO when applying, one will be selected for you. As a Horizon NJ Health member, you do not need referrals to see in-network specialists and have no or low copays for primary care office visits and preventive services.
To be eligible for NJ FamilyCare, your income and household size will be assessed. You can apply for coverage through the Get Covered New Jersey application, which will determine if you qualify for financial help to lower the cost of your plan or if you may be eligible for NJ FamilyCare. Residents may enrol in NJ FamilyCare year-round.
